The DIG RNA Labeling Kit is based on the in vitro transcription of a template cDNA. cDNA is cloned into the polylinker site of a transcription vector (supplied) containing SP6 and T7 promoters. Digoxigenin (DIG) -labeled UTP is incorporated (approximately in a ratio with UTP) into the transcript, generating DIG-labeled RNAs. 10 DIG RNA Labeling Kit (SP6/T7), RNase Inhibitor • Solution, 20 U/μl • Prevents the degradation of RNA during the labeling reaction. 1 vial, 20 μl 11 DIG RNA Labeling Kit (SP6/T7), SP6 RNA Polymerase • Solution, 20 U/μl • Synthesizes RNA from a DNA template. 1 vial, 20 μl 12 DIG RNA Labeling Kit (SP6/T7), T7 RNA Polymerase.
